The Anambra State House of Assembly has continued to set right and positive paces for others to emulate. Particularly, the Leadership of the House, under the firm control of Rt. Hon. Rita Maduagwu, has distinguished itself, setting a new record in Legislative Crisis Management. 

Madam Speaker, who is also a Learned Lawyer, has emboldened the laws in her conduct and utterances.

It was this consideration and more that led her colleagues to pass a Vote Of Confidence on her leadership. Recall that Madam Speaker had, in the course of the unanticipated conundrum maintained that;

 

– Protesting Legislators were driven more by political consideration than Legislative interest.

 

– Their “sincere” agitation should not be placed above the collective interest and peace of the State.

 

– They had Legal and Political alternatives to seeking for redress.

 

– The legislature cannot be used as a tool for personal vendetta or political reprisals.

 

– There is no alternative to peace. Even when the errant Legislators attempted to muscle their way through inappropriate legislative conducts.

 

– She has continued to enjoy the support of Majority of her colleagues who stood firm against her purported impeachment.

 

Rt. Hon. Rita Maduagwu continues to signpost the best form of diplomacy. To her credit, the House is back in top gear as one independent and indivisible entity.
